From: bigwavedave on 9 Jul 2008 23:07 Left side of keyboard on laptop types correct characters, right side of key board does not. Could not find 'help' on help menu. Any help?
From: Carmen Gauvin-O'Donnell on 10 Jul 2008 07:45 Have you perhaps accidently pressed the Fn (purple) key which is probably on the lower left of your keyboard and then the Numeral Lock key (a little purple lock with a number 1 in it, probably on the scroll key in the upper right of your keyboard)? When you do that, the M./JKL;UIOP7890 keys turn into a numeric keypad and won't type letters. From: Beverly Howard [Ms-MVP/MobileDev] on 11 Jul 2008 11:29 A related point... if you use the docking station or external keyboard to use a full keyboard with a number pad, having the <numlock> on for that configuration will often create this situation. Beverly Howard [MS MVP-Mobile Devices]
